Health EffectsHealth Effects
SICK BUILDING SYNDROME (SBS)
VS
BUILDING RELATED ILLNESS (BRI)

Health EffectsHealth Effects
•SICK BUILDING SYNDROME (SBS)
–A PERSISTENT SET OF SYMPTOMS IN > 20%
–CAUSE(S) NOT RECOGNIZABLE
–COMPLAINTS/SYMPTOMS RELIEVED AFTER
EXITING BUILDING

Health EffectsHealth Effects
•SICK BUILDING SYNDROME (SBS)
–EYE, NOSE, OR THROAT IRRITATION
–HEADACHES
–FATIGUE
–REDUCED MENTATION
–IRRITABILITY

Health EffectsHealth Effects
•SICK BUILDING SYNDROME (SBS)
–DRY SKIN
–NASAL CONGESTION
–DIFFICULTY BREATHING
–NOSE BLEEDS
–NAUSEA

Health EffectsHealth Effects
•BUILDING RELATED ILLNESS (BRI)
–CLINICALLY RECOGNIZED DISEASE
–EXPOSURE TO INDOOR AIR
POLLUTANTS
–RECOGNIZABLE CAUSES

Health EffectsHealth Effects
•BUILDING RELATED ILLNESS (BRI)
–PONTIAC FEVER - LEGIONELLA spp.
–LEGIONNAIRE’S DISEASE
–HYPERSENSITIVITY PNEUMONITIS
–HUMIDIFIER FEVER

Health EffectsHealth Effects
•BUILDING RELATED ILLNESS (BRI)
–ASTHMA
–ALLERGY
–RESPIRATORY DISEASE
•CHRONIC OBSTRUCTIVE PULMONARY
DISEASE (COPD)

Causative Agents

Causative AgentsCausative Agents
•INDOOR AIR CONTAMINANT TYPES
–COMBUSTION PRODUCTS
–VOLATILE CHEMICALS & MIXTURES
–RESPIRABLE PARTICULATES
–RESPIRATORY PRODUCTS
–BIOLOGICS & BIOAEROSOLS
–RADIONUCLIDES
–ODORS

Causative AgentsCausative Agents
•COMBUSTION PRODUCTS
–CARBON MONOXIDE (CO)
–OXIDES OF NITROGEN (NO
X
)
–OXIDES OF SULFUR (SO
X
)
–CARBON DIOXIDE (CO
2
)
–POLYAROMATIC HYDROCARBON ’S (PAH)
–TOBACCO SMOKE COMPONENTS

Causative AgentsCausative Agents
•VOLATILE ORGANIC CHEMICALS
–ALCOHOLS - ISOPROPANOL
–ALDEHYDES - FORMALDEHYDE
–ALIPHATICS - CYCLOHEXANE
–AROMATIC HYDROCARBONS - 4PC
–ESTERS - ETHYL ACETATE
–HALOGENATED HYDROCARBONS -
TCE

Causative AgentsCausative Agents
•RESPIRABLE PARTICULATES
–ASBESTOS
•CHRYSOTILE
•AMOSITE
•CROCIDOLITE
–FIBERGLASS
–INORGANIC DUSTS (MINERAL)

Causative AgentsCausative Agents
•RESPIRABLE PARTICULATES
–METALLIC DUSTS
•LEAD
–ORGANIC DUSTS
–PAPER DUSTS
–POLLEN

Causative AgentsCausative Agents
•RESPIRATORY PRODUCTS
–WATER VAPOR
–CARBON DIOXIDE (CO
2)
–ETIOLOGICAL AGENTS
–TOBACCO SMOKE COMPONENTS

Causative AgentsCausative Agents
•BIOLOGICS & BIOAEROSOLS
–MOLDS & FUNGI
–BACTERIA
–PROTOZOA
–VIRUSES

Causative AgentsCausative Agents
•RADIONUCLIDES
–RADON
–RADON PROGENY (DAUGHTERS)

Causative AgentsCausative Agents
•ODORS
–ODORS ASSOCIATED WITH ANY INDOOR AIR
CONTAMINANT TYPE
•INDEPENDENTLY
•IN COMBINATION

SourcesSources

SourcesSources
•COMBUSTION PRODUCTS
–KEROSENE HEATERS
–LOADING DOCKS
–WOOD STOVES/UNVENTED GAS STOVES
–NEARBY TRAFFIC

SourcesSources
•VOLATILE CHEMICALS & MIXTURES
-ADHESIVES & CAULKING COMPOUNDS
-CARPETING & DRAPERY
-PARTICLE BOARD

SourcesSources
•VOLATILE CHEMICALS & MIXTURES
–FLOOR & WALL COVERINGS
–PAINTS, VARNISHES AND STAINS
–UPHOLSTERY

SourcesSources
•RESPIRABLE PARTICULATES
–ENVIRONMENTAL TOBACCO SMOKE (ETS)
–CONSTRUCTION DEBRIS
–OUTDOOR AIR
–PLANTS & PLANT PARTS
–PRODUCTION PROCESSES

SourcesSources
PARTICULATE PHASE OF
CIGARETTE SMOKE
4-AMINOBIPHENYL NICKEL
ANATABINE NICOTINE
ANILINEPHENOL
BENZ[A]ANTHRACENE POLONIUM-210
BENZ[A]PYRENE QUINOLINE
BENZOIC ACID SUCCINIC ACID
BUTYROLACTONE 2-TOLUIDINE
NITROSODIETHANOLAMINE CADMIUM

SourcesSources
VAPOR PHASE OF
CIGARETTE SMOKE
HYDROGEN CYANIDE ACETALDEHYDE
ACETONE ACROLEIN
1,3-BUTADIENE BENZENE
CARBON MONOXIDE FORMALDEHYDE
DIMETHYLAMINE HYDRAZINE
CARBONYL SULFIDE ETHANE
METHYL CHLORIDE PYRIDINE
AMMONIA FORMIC ACID

SourcesSources
•RESPIRATORY PRODUCTS
–PEOPLE
–PLANTS

SourcesSources
•BIOLOGICS & BIOAEROSOLS
–HVAC SYSTEMS
–COOLING TOWERS
–HUMANS/ANIMALS
–STAGNANT WATER RESERVOIRS
–HUMIDIFIERS

SourcesSources
•RADIONUCLIDES (RADON -
222
Rn)
–SOIL
–WATER
–BUILDING MATERIALS
–NATURAL GAS

Control
Methodologies

Control MethodologiesControl Methodologies
•PREVENTING IAQ PROBLEMS
–SOURCES OUTSIDE THE BUILDING
–EQUIPMENT
–HUMAN ACTIVITIES
–BUILDING COMPONENTS & FURNISHINGS
–OTHER SOURCES
–VENTILATION TO MEET OCCUPANT NEEDS
–OTHER CONSIDERATIONS

Control MethodologiesControl Methodologies
•SOURCES OUTSIDE THE BUILDING
–CONTAMINATED OUTDOOR AIR
•POLLEN, DUST, FUNGI
•INDUSTRIAL POLLUTANTS
•GENERAL VEHICLE EXHAUST

Control MethodologiesControl Methodologies
•SOURCES OUTSIDE THE BUILDING
–EMISSIONS FROM NEARBY SOURCES
•PARKING LOTS/GARAGES
•LOADING DOCKS/DUMPSTERS
•RE-ENTRAINED BUILDING EXHAUST
•LOCATION OF SUPPLY INTAKES

Control MethodologiesControl Methodologies
•SOURCES OUTSIDE THE BUILDING
–SOIL GAS

RADON

UNDERGROUND STORAGE TANKS (LEAKING)

LANDFILL

PESTICIDE APPLICATION

Control MethodologiesControl Methodologies
•SOURCES OUTSIDE THE BUILDING
–STANDING WATER
•ROOFTOPS
•CRAWLSPACES

Control MethodologiesControl Methodologies
•EQUIPMENT
–HVAC SYSTEM

DUST/DIRT/GROWTH IN DUCTS

GROWTH IN DRIP PANS

IMPROPER USE OF BIOCIDES

IMPROPER VENTING

Control MethodologiesControl Methodologies
•EQUIPMENT
–NON-HVAC EQUIPMENT
•EMISSIONS FROM OFFICE EQUIPMENT
•SUPPLIES (SOLVENTS, TONERS, ETC.)
•EMISSIONS FROM LABS, CLEANING
•OTHER MECHANICAL SYSTEMS

Control MethodologiesControl Methodologies
•HUMAN ACTIVITIES
–PERSONAL ACTIVIITES
•SMOKING
•COOKING
•PERSONAL HYGIENE (BODY ODORS)
•COSMETIC ODORS

Control MethodologiesControl Methodologies
•HUMAN ACTIVITIES
–HOUSEKEEPING ACTIVIITES

CLEANING MATERIALS

CLEANING PROCEDURES

STORED SUPPLIES & TRASH

DEODORIZERS & FRAGRANCES

Control MethodologiesControl Methodologies
•HUMAN ACTIVITIES
–MAINTENANCE ACTIVIITES
•COOLING TOWERS
•PAINTS, CAULKS, ETC.
•PEST CONTROL
•STORED SUPPLIES

Control MethodologiesControl Methodologies
•BUILDING COMPONENTS & FURNISHINGS
–LOCATIONS THAT COLLECT DUST
–DAMAGED MATERIALS
–UNSANITARY CONDITIONS

Control MethodologiesControl Methodologies
•BUILDING COMPONENTS &
FURNISHINGS
–WATER DAMAGE
–DRY TRAPS - SEWER GAS
–CHEMICAL RELEASE OR OFF-GASING

Control MethodologiesControl Methodologies
•OTHER SOURCES
–ACCIDENTAL EVENTS

SPILLS

FLOODING

FIRE DAMAGE (PCB’S)

Control MethodologiesControl Methodologies
•OTHER SOURCES
–SPECIAL USE AREAS

SMOKING LOUNGES

LABORATORIES

PRINT SHOPS

ART ROOMS - GRAPHIC DESIGN

Control MethodologiesControl Methodologies
•OTHER SOURCES
–SPECIAL USE AREAS

EXERCISE ROOMS

BEAUTY SALONS

FOOD PREPARATION AREAS

Control MethodologiesControl Methodologies
•OTHER SOURCES
–REDECORATING/REMODELING/REPAIR

NEW FURNISHINGS

DUST & FIBERS FROM DEMOLITION

ODORS & VOC’S (PAINT, ETC.)

MICROBIOLOGICALS FROM DEMOLITION

Control MethodologiesControl Methodologies
•VENTILATION TO MEET OCCUPANT
NEEDS
–ASHRAE STANDARDS (ASHRAE 62-
1989)

TEMPERATURE

RELATIVE HUMIDITY

MINIMUM OUTDOOR AIR REQUIREMENTS

CO
2 LEVELS BELOW 1000 PPM

Control MethodologiesControl Methodologies
•VENTILATION TO MEET OCCUPANT
NEEDS
–ENGINEERING CONTROLS

MODIFY VENTILATION SYSTEM

MODIFY PRESSURE RELATIONSHIPS

FILTERS

Control MethodologiesControl Methodologies
•VENTILATION TO MEET OCCUPANT
NEEDS
–ENGINEERING CONTROLS
•PRECIPITATORS
•ION GENERATORS
•HUMIDIFICATION SYSTEMS

Control MethodologiesControl Methodologies
•OTHER CONSIDERATIONS
–POPULATION DENSITY
–LIGHTING
–NOISE
–ERGONOMICS

Control MethodologiesControl Methodologies
•OTHER CONSIDERATIONS
–MANAGEMENT STYLES
–MONITORED WORK STATIONS
–RE-ENTRY CRITERIA
